Transaction ef516b074886cfc1d4f36b8baa0d1b250d36196ed74f400725f0de0e540ccdfd
4 Input
1 Outputs
- ef516b074886cfc1d4f36b8baa0d1b250d36196ed74f400725f0de0e540ccdfd:0
value 600000
address 3BqJKJEo2FUMdfzJtgPEkgoRaJ48KoBKXL